A resting electrocardiogram (ECG), also known as a standard ECG, is a common diagnostic tool used to evaluate the heart rhythm of your heart while you are at a stationary position. During the test, small electrodes are attached to your chest, arms, and legs to capture the impulses produced by your heart as it contracts. The resulting graphs provide valuable insights about your heart's health, including its frequency, rhythm, and the presence of any abnormalities.
A resting ECG is a safe, painless, and non-invasive procedure. It can be used to identify a variety of heart conditions, such as arrhythmias, coronary artery disease, and heart failure.
- It is important to note that a resting ECG may not always detect all potential heart problems.
- As a result, your doctor may order further examinations if needed.

Continuous Ambulatory Holter Monitoring
Continuous ambulatory holter monitoring, also referred to as a holter monitor, is a proven method for recording the heart's electrical activity over an extended period. This non-invasive device facilitates physicians to identify potential problems that may not be apparent during a short electrocardiogram (ECG) test. Patients usually carry the holter monitor for 24 hours or even up to several days, recording their heart rhythm continuously during daily activities. The collected data is then analyzed by a cardiologist, who can determine a diagnosis and recommend appropriate treatment options.
